正面描述 Stylized Celtic male head facing right, rendered in the distinctive La Tène artistic tradition derived from Macedonian prototypes. The hair is elaborately depicted as a mass of bold, leaf-like strands swept rearward, crowned with a prominent twisted or knotted diadem composed of pellet clusters. The facial features are highly abstracted, with a large almond-shaped eye rendered as a raised pellet within a curved socket, a schematic nose, and a simplified lower face. Decorative subsidiary elements including crescent and scroll motifs appear in the lower field, while a small rosette or star ornament is visible near the neck, reflecting characteristic Celtic adaptation of Hellenistic iconography.

背面描述 A stylized horse prancing left, rendered in the abstract Celtic manner derived from Macedonian tetradrachm prototypes. The animal's body is rendered with smooth, rounded forms, while the mane is depicted as a series of bold leaf-shaped projections above the neck. The tail is elaborately stylized into multiple parallel curved lines terminating in pellets, and the forelegs are resolved into elaborate lyre-shaped or trident-like appendages with pellet terminals, a hallmark of East Norican Celtic coinage. A small running human figure, possibly a jockey or attendant, appears below the horse's belly in the lower left field, and a circular pellet grouping is visible at the horse's chest.
